The basic technique use by etherboot is: In 32bit mode handle no interrupts. When you want to do a BIOS call switch to 16bit mode enable interrupts do the call. disable interrupts and switch back to 32bit mode. As far as I can tell this is a similar idea to what you are doing in genesis. etherboot doesn't need everything so it doesn't handle the general case. That may have been the original reason. But the reason to keep the code that way is so we work with loadlin, (and any kin it might have). I have tested it and after you are loaded by loadlin you cannot go back and make BIOS calls. The problem is that dos TSR's and device drivers have intercepted BIOS interrupts, and we stomp all over those. It may be possible to overcome this by saving the state of the entire dos session but to be safe we would need to take a core dump of the entire machine. And for such little gain I don't think that is worth it. Eric
